About this service

Springs are the heavy-duty coils that counterbalance the door's weight so the opener can move it easily. If your door feels incredibly heavy, won't lift, or you see a visible gap in the coil, the springs are likely broken. Because replacing these requires specialized tools and carries safety risks, professional service is necessary.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

What's the difference between chain drive and belt drive garage door openers?

In Milwaukee, chain drive openers utilize a metal chain to move the trolley, offering robust power and durability often at a lower cost. Belt drive openers, conversely, use a rubber belt, providing quieter operation which is ideal for attached garages. Both systems have their advantages, and the choice often depends on your priorities for noise level and budget. What does garage door service near me typically include?

Garage door service near you in Milwaukee typically includes a comprehensive inspection of your entire garage door system, from the panels and tracks to the springs, cables, and opener. Technicians perform lubrication of moving parts, balance checks, and safety sensor adjustments. They identify potential issues before they become major problems, ensuring your door operates safely and efficiently.
